Abstract
This work describes a set of interfaces for augmenting fast-forward and rewind on consumer digital video recorders. Our method overlays a series of images sampled from the video over top of the traditional full screen accelerated playback. This sequence creates a trail that provides contextual information and highlights upcoming scene changes in the video stream. With this augmentation, consumers are more accurate at traversing to a desired location in a recorded video. This advantage is achieved by taking advantage of compressed-domain processing and adds little computational and storage overhead.
